Alright, I've got a head-scratcher here with my '99 Civic. It's been running like a champ most of the time, but lately, it's started stalling out at idle when the AC is on. No issues otherwise, just this weird behavior with the climate control engaged.

I've checked the basics - fuel pressure seems fine, and there are no leaks evident from the fuel system. I'm wondering if it might be a faulty fuel pump or some kind of sensor issue. Has anyone else run into something like this? Any insights would be much appreciated.
